Opinions on Ebay Portsmouth Band item
http://www.ebay.co.uk/itm/2709508669...84.m1423.l2649
Is what is said to be original WWI Portsmouth Band cap badge (but that would make it the original RMA band cap badge that the Portsmouth one derived from I think) I have my doubts (as I have had with several 'originals' from this seller) and would appreciate other's opinions. Aspects I do not like is the smooth back rather than being shaped as a pressed badge would be, the shape of the top centre of the grenade's flame and the bland detail of the berries on the laurel leaf. I'd also like opinions on attached pictures of 3 variations I have. The outer two are 'modern' style with slight variations but generally similar in design to each other. The middle one appears older and is different in a couple of ways: The V in the middle of the cypher is much smaller, the crown is not voided but seems crafted as if to represent the velvet cloth sloping back to the rear centre of the crown - and the berries on the laurel stand out from it. I'd love to think this is an orignal RMA badge but guess it is more likely that, if it is an original badge, it is merely an earlier design. Ray |
